WebDan Pink: The puzzle of motivation, a summary. There is a mismatch between what science knows and what business does. Science knows that the 20th century tiered financial rewards do not improve performance and can even destroy creativity. The secret to high-performance is that unseen intrinsic drive– the drive to do things for their own sake. WebWhat Is Motivation 3.0?
